卡群电站压力前池防冰塞设计与试验研究  被引量:2

Design and experiment research on the fore bay of Kaqun hydropower station to prevent ice block

在线阅读下载全文

作  者:严跃成[1] 

机构地区:[1]新疆大学建筑工程学院

出  处:《山西建筑》2010年第20期364-365,共2页Shanxi Architecture

摘  要:通过卡群电站工程实例,研究讨论了引水式电站冬季输排冰运行的条件和电站前池布局的合理性,对引水式电站前池的各关键部位,提出了具体防冰塞措施,并对SL 211-2006水工建筑物抗冰冻设计规范中的若干问题进行了讨论,供设计、研究人员参考。Through some project examples of Kaqun hydropower station, this paper researches and analysis the conditions for ice sluicing structures of using the diversion canal type of hydroelectric power stations and the layout rationality of power plant fore bay. And it introduces some concrete measures for preventing ice block on the key part of the fore bay of diversion canal type of hydroelectric power stations.. In addition, the author puts forward some own opinions about some issues in the SL 211-2006 Code for design of hydraulic structures against ice and freezing action to provide some references for designers and researchers.

关 键 词:压力前池 冰塞 输排冰 流速
